How a Successful Deep Cleaning Transformed This Space

Maintaining a clean environment is crucial for both homes and businesses, but sometimes regular cleaning just isn’t enough. That’s where a deep cleaning comes in—targeting dirt, grime, and hidden allergens that standard cleaning can miss. Here’s a look at how a successful deep cleaning session completely transformed one space, along with key steps and benefits to help you understand the process.


The Space: What Needed Attention

This particular deep cleaning project took place in a busy office that hadn’t been cleaned thoroughly in months. Over time, dust had accumulated in hidden corners, and high-touch surfaces had built up layers of grime. Carpets needed deep extraction, while restrooms and kitchens required intensive sanitization. The challenge was to not only make the space look clean but to create a healthier environment for employees.


Key Steps in the Deep Cleaning Process

  1. Initial Inspection and Custom Plan: Every deep cleaning starts with an inspection of the space to determine the areas that need the most attention. In this case, the high-traffic zones, carpets, and shared areas like the kitchen and restrooms were prioritized.
  2. Decluttering and Surface Cleaning: Before tackling deep cleaning tasks, we removed clutter and cleaned surfaces to ensure dust and dirt weren’t simply moved around during the deep cleaning.
  3. Detailed Dusting and Vacuuming: Our team used high-quality vacuums with HEPA filters to remove dust, allergens, and particles from carpets, upholstery, and hard-to-reach areas like air vents and ceiling fans.
  4. Carpet and Floor Deep Cleaning: Using professional-grade equipment, we performed deep extraction on carpets to remove embedded dirt and stains. Hard floors were mopped, scrubbed, and polished for a spotless finish.
  5. Disinfection of High-Touch Areas: Special attention was given to sanitizing high-touch surfaces such as light switches, door handles, desks, and appliances to ensure the space was germ-free.
  6. Restroom and Kitchen Sanitization: The kitchen and restrooms required deep scrubbing, descaling of fixtures, and disinfection. These areas were brought up to the highest hygiene standards, ensuring a safe environment for staff.
  7. Finishing Touches: The final step involved making sure no detail was overlooked—from polishing fixtures to cleaning windows and ensuring all areas smelled fresh and clean.

The Results: A Transformed Space

After the deep cleaning session, the transformation was clear. The carpets looked refreshed, high-traffic areas were free of dust and grime, and the entire office had a renewed sense of cleanliness. Staff members reported improved indoor air quality and felt more comfortable in their workspace. The deep cleaning also helped to extend the life of furniture, carpets, and other office materials.


Benefits of Scheduling a Deep Cleaning

  • Healthier Environment: Removing allergens, dust, and bacteria creates a healthier space, reducing the risk of illnesses and allergic reactions.
  • Improved Appearance: Deep cleaning eliminates dirt and stains that regular cleaning can miss, making your space look spotless and professional.
  • Extended Lifespan of Surfaces: Thorough cleaning helps prevent wear and tear on carpets, furniture, and other surfaces, saving you money in the long run.
  • Better Air Quality: Deep cleaning removes particles from the air, improving indoor air quality and reducing respiratory issues.
  • Boosted Productivity: Employees working in a clean, organized environment often feel more motivated and focused.
